Teradata and SAP Join Forces to
Deliver Strategic Enterprise Analytical Solutions
New alliance to target multiple industries with high data-volume requirements
NEW ZEALAND, Auckland – Teradata, a division of NCR Corporation (NYSE: NCR), and SAP AG (NYSE: SAP) today announced a
technology partnership agreement to deliver analytical solutions to targeted industries with high data-volume
requirements, including telecommunications, financial services, pharmaceuticals and aerospace and defense.
Companies in these high data-volume industries will be able to easily integrate enterprise analytical solutions with
their SAP® solutions, resulting in faster time-to-market, lower total cost of ownership and improved business
efficiencies.
The relationship will provide customers with a single, integrated view of their business by delivering industry-specific
analytical solutions that are highly scalable and offer a rapid return on investment. As part of the agreement, Teradata
also becomes an SAP Global Technology Partner.

Teradata will be combining the best of its analytic applications portfolio and platform with SAP’s deep industry
knowledge and leading business software solutions, powered by SAP NetWeaver™, the open integration and application
platform designed to drive lower total cost of ownership across heterogeneous information technology landscapes.
Through tightly integrated interoperability between Teradata’s enterprise data warehouse products and SAP NetWeaver,
joint customers will have access to Teradata’s scalable enterprise analytic capabilities fully integrated with SAP
NetWeaver. Customers can enjoy Teradata’s analytic capabilities combined with the industry-leading business intelligence
capabilities of SAP NetWeaver.

About SAP
SAP is the world’s leading provider of business software solutions. SAP® solutions are designed to meet the demands of
companies of all sizes – from small and midsize businesses to global enterprises. Powered by the SAP NetWeaver™ open
integration and application platform to reduce complexity and total cost of ownership and empower business change and
innovation, mySAP™ Business Suite solutions are helping enterprises around the world improve customer relationships,
enhance partner collaboration and create efficiencies across their supply chains and business operations. The unique
core processes of various industries, from aerospace to utilities, are supported by SAP’s industry-specific solution
portfolios. Today, more than 21,600 customers in over 120 countries run more than 69,700 installations of SAP® software.
With subsidiaries in more than 50 countries, the company is listed on several exchanges, including the Frankfurt stock
exchange and NYSE under the symbol “SAP.” (Additional information at )
